Historically, the concept of securing one’s home in Pakistan was primarily limited to traditional methods—locks on doors, grills on windows, and perhaps a watchman for larger properties. However, the rise of technology has introduced a new era of shocking home security options. The early 2000s saw the first wave of electronic security systems entering the market, often limited to affluent neighborhoods. These initial systems were costly, with prices starting at around PKR 50,000, making them accessible only to the privileged few.
As awareness grew and crime rates fluctuated, numerous companies began to innovate, offering varied products at competitive prices. Today, you can find basic DIY security kits starting from as low as PKR 15,000, making shocking home security more accessible to the average homeowner. This democratization of security options has led to a thriving market filled with brands like Hikvision, which offers a range of cameras and alarms, and D-Link, known for its user-friendly smart home devices. - Smart Cameras: These devices now come equipped with features such as motion detection, night vision, and even facial recognition. Brands like Hikvision and Dahua are leading the charge with products that allow homeowners to monitor their properties from anywhere using their smartphones.
- Alarm Systems: Modern alarm systems are more than just loud noises. They integrate with smart technology, sending alerts to your phone if something unusual is detected. Companies like Yale offer comprehensive kits that can be customized to fit any home.
- Home Automation: Home security is now a part of the broader smart home ecosystem. Devices like smart locks and doorbell cameras, such as those from Ring, enhance security by allowing homeowners to control access remotely.
- Wireless Technology: Gone are the days of complicated wiring. Many new systems operate wirelessly, making installation easier and more flexible. Brands like Arlo offer completely wireless camera systems that are both user-friendly and effective.
- AI Integration: Some systems utilize artificial intelligence to learn patterns in your daily routine, alerting you to any irregularities. This technology is becoming increasingly common in high-end security systems.

Let’s explore some case studies that reveal just how varied and surprising the landscape of home security prices can be.
- DIY Kits: A popular choice for budget-conscious homeowners, basic DIY security kits start at around PKR 15,000. Brands like VGuard and Hikvision offer packages that include motion sensors, cameras, and alarm systems, allowing users to set up their own security solutions without professional installation.
- Mid-Range Solutions: For those willing to invest a bit more, systems priced between PKR 30,000 and PKR 70,000 provide enhanced features such as remote monitoring and smartphone integration. Dahua Technology is a notable brand in this category, offering comprehensive solutions that cater to growing security needs.
- High-End Systems: If budget is less of a concern, high-end security systems can range from PKR 100,000 and beyond. These systems often include advanced technologies such as facial recognition and 24/7 professional monitoring. Brands like ADT are leading the charge, providing unparalleled safety for discerning homeowners.
